    In this excerpt Kass is presenting his testimony to the National Bioethics Advisory Commission‚ in which he urges the commission to declare human cloning unethical. Kass’s argument is based on: considerations related to the ethics of experimentation‚ concerns about identity and individuality‚ the dangers of transforming procreation into manufacture‚ and the negative impact upon out understanding of what it means to have children.
